Emirates passenger admits acting indecently on flight from Dubai to Newcastle

Britto Lorence was travelling on the long-haul journey from Dubai when he exposed himself in front of a woman and child

A perverted plane passenger exposed himself and acted indecently in front of a mother and her very young child during a busy Emirates flight to Newcastle. Britto Lorence was travelling on the long-haul journey from Dubai in June last year and had been sat beside the woman and her infant son .

A court heard that, as the woman got up to make her child a feed, she noticed that the 27-year-old had a blanket over his lap and his and he was acting indecently.

The pervert, of Abingdon Road, Middlesbrough, was reported to cabin crew and arrested upon arrival at Newcastle International Airport. As previously reported on Chroniclelive, he appeared in the dock earlier this year to plead not guilty to one count of outraging public decency and the case was listed for trial.

However, on the day the trial was due to start at Newcastle Magistrates’ Court this week, he changed his plea to guilty on the basis that he had exposed himself but was not performing a sex act. Brian Payne, prosecuting, said Lorence had been sat beside the victim and her child on an Emirates flight between Dubai and Newcastle on June 2 last year.

Mr Payne said: “[The victim] described the male [Lorence] having a pillow on his lap and he initially appeared to be asleep.”

However Mr Payne said the woman then spotted he was acting indecently.

Mr Payne continued: “She raised the alarm by going to cabin staff.”

In a statement, the victim said she had been “deeply distressed” by the incident but had tried not to get too alarmed on the flight for the sake of her son. Andy O’Hanlon, defending, said he had submissions to make on Lorence’s behalf but conceded a pre-sentence report would need to be prepared.

Adjourning the case for sentence on June 2, District Judge Kate Meek said: “All sentencing options remain open, including the option of an immediate custodial sentence or this being committed to the crown court for sentence.”
